MV-CEA is a recombinant oncolytic measles virus (derived from the Edmonston vaccine strain, MV-Edm) engineered to express the soluble extracellular domain of human carcinoembryonic antigen (CEA). The expressed CEA serves as a tumor-associated marker that can be detected in serum, allowing for non-invasive monitoring of viral gene expression and treatment response. MV-CEA selectively infects and kills tumor cells due to their high expression of CD46, which facilitates viral entry, while sparing normal cells with low CD46 density. Its mechanism involves direct oncolysis through syncytia formation and induction of proinflammatory changes in the tumor microenvironment. Clinical trials have evaluated its safety and preliminary efficacy in recurrent glioblastoma multiforme (GBM), ovarian cancer confined to the peritoneal cavity, oligodendroglioma, peritoneal neoplasms, and preclinical studies suggest potential utility in prostate cancer. No dose-limiting toxicities have been observed up to maximum tested doses; treatment has shown disease stabilization and favorable survival outcomes compared with historical controls[1][4][5][6][8].
